Short Interest in Northern Technologies International Corporation (NASDAQ:NTIC) Declines By 36.5%

Northern Technologies International Corporation (NASDAQ:NTICGet Free Report) was the target of a large decline in short interest during the month of August. As of August 31st, there was short interest totaling 9,371 shares, a decline of 36.5% from the August 15th total of 14,752 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 5,942 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 1.6 days. Currently, 0.1% of the shares of the company are sold short.

Northern Technologies International Company Profile

Northern Technologies International Corporation (NASDAQ: NTIC) develops and markets products and services designed to protect materials from corrosion and support more sustainable packaging and plastics applications. The company’s corrosion-management business operates primarily under the Zerust brand and serves industrial customers that need to protect metal components and equipment during storage, transportation and manufacturing.

Zerust products include corrosion-inhibiting packaging, films, foams, emitters, coatings, oils and other solutions that help prevent corrosion without requiring traditional protective treatments.
